The Tennis Courts at 952 Avenue Southwest in Federal Way, Washington, are available by membership only. The courts are outdoors and do not have lights, so you will need to plan your playtime accordingly. There are no bathrooms or water facilities on-site, and no backboards are available. Reservations are not required to use the courts.
